Dubai, March 6, 2012: Dr. Melodena Stephens Balakrishnan, Associate Professor, Faculty of Business and Management, UOWD, presented the second volume of the case study book series "Actions and Insights: Middle East North Africa" to the UAE Minister of Foreign Trade, Her Excellency Sheikha Lubna bint Khalid Al Qasimi, in the presence of the Undersecretary Abdulla A. Al Saleh at the Ministry of Foreign Trade in Abu Dhabi recently.

The new book carries an article about 'Managing in Uncertain Times' which is also the theme of the book. The 12 cases have been edited by Dr. Balakrishnan, Dr. Ian Michael of UOWD, Dr. Tim Rogmans of Zayed University and Immanuel Azaad Moonesar, Institutional Research Officer, UOWD.

The cases document a range of situations tackled by companies like Abraaj Capital Limited, Noor Dubai Foundation, Etihad Airways, Al Ain Diary case, Jumeirah Group, Haier, Advanced Technology Investment Company (ATIC) and Sharjah Football Club.

The book was published through the funding generated through AIB-MENA in partnership with the UOWD Business Case Centre. The project was realized through the

sponsorship of Al Ain Dairy, Abraaj Capital Ltd, Jumeriah Group, Zayed University, Dubai Convention Bureau (DTCM), Al Arif Sons Travel and Al Sharif Chartered Accountants.

The book is published by Emerald Publishing Group and each individual case is available online on the Emerald Emerging Market Case Studies website (including a free sample case on Abraaj Capital Ltd.). The book series is available through Amazon.com.

"The cases are being used in classes across the world and many of the AIB-MENA cases are the most downloaded cases in the Emerald Emerging Market Case Studies Collection," said Dr. Balakrishnan.

The first book in the series was launched in May 2011 by Her Excellency Sheikha Lubna at the University of Wollongong in Dubai at a special ceremony.
